Nine student-athletes and a championship team have been selected for membership in the Bedford High School Sports Hall of fame; they will be honored at an induction ceremony and awards dinner on April 11.
The honorees and some of their credentials are:
Jennifer Champney
Class of 2006: 1,000-point career in basketball and soccer for both Bedford High and Wheaton College, qualifier for state high jump, captain in basketball, field hockey, track.
Gerry Cohen
Class of 2008: Four-year basketball starter, three-time Dual County League basketball MVP, named to Boston Globe all-scholastic 2008, second leading all-time scorer at BHS.
Joe LaDow
Class of 1972: three-year starter and two-year all-star in football, two-year starter and all-star in basketball, distinguished career as local firefighter and life-saving emergency medical technician.
Terrance Favors
Class of 2008: Four-year varsity basketball, DCL and Boston Herald all-scholastic 2008, New England Collegiate Conference player-of-the-year at Becker College 2012, second all-time scoring leader at Becker, current swingman for South Florida Spartans developmental team.
Jonathan Gault
Class of 2009: Second in Division 2 state two-mile, third in state Division 2 cross-country 2008, Eastern Massachusetts Division 4 cross-country champion 2008, Boston Globe, Boston Herald (twice) all- scholastic, successful distance running career at Dartmouth College,.
Liam Hurley
Class of 1990: Leading rebounder, second-leading scorer as a senior on 16-5 basketball team, league all-star in basketball and soccer, number one singles player in tennis.
John Isnor
Class of 1982: League MVP in hockey as a junior, and a golfer and all-star two-way football player whose high school career ended with a serious injury on a punt return in October 1980.
Vin McGrath
Class of 1998: Multiple-year all-star in football, establishing 40-year school passing records; also played basketball and baseball, quarterback at Merrimack College, assistant football and basketball coach at BHS for past decade.
Colleen Strachan
Class of 2008: A three-sport captain (soccer, basketball, lacrosse) and six-time league all-star, fifth-leading all-time scorer in lacrosse at Merrimack College, female scholar-athlete of the year 2011. Girls’ cross-country team, 1974, league and district champion, second place in state meet.
Girls’ Cross-Country Team
1974: League and district champion, second place in state meet.
